Just how the symbols that are used to represent circuit elements only represent the functionality of the elements and not the physical shape, so will the lumped-element model for transmission lines. Transmission lines will be represented by a parallel wire configuration regardless of its specific shape or constitutive parameters. Lines will be oriented along the z directing and subdivided into differential sections each of length . Each section will be represented by an individual.
